Common Cleaning Techniques
Compressed Air
Using compressed air is a popular method for removing dust from vents and keyboard crevices. It is quick and effective if used correctly, ensuring no residue remains.
Microfiber Cloth
A soft microfiber cloth can gently wipe down the screen and exterior surfaces. It is ideal for removing fingerprints and smudges without scratching.
Isopropyl Alcohol Wipes
For disinfecting and cleaning stubborn stains, isopropyl alcohol wipes are effective. They should be used sparingly and avoided on delicate screens without proper protection.
Cleaning Techniques Specific to Razer Blade 14
The Razer Blade 14’s design requires careful cleaning to avoid damaging sensitive components. Manufacturers recommend avoiding excessive moisture and using tools designed for electronics.
Screen Cleaning
Use a microfiber cloth slightly dampened with water or a screen-safe cleaner. Avoid spraying liquids directly onto the screen.
Keyboard and Vent Cleaning
Compressed air is ideal for cleaning the keyboard and vents. For stubborn grime, a soft brush can be used alongside compressed air.

Best Practices for Cleaning
- Always power off and unplug the device before cleaning.
- Use minimal moisture; avoid dripping liquids into openings.
- Employ soft, lint-free tools like microfiber cloths and brushes.
- Regularly clean vents and keyboard to prevent dust accumulation.
- Follow manufacturer guidelines for cleaning products and techniques.
